Nothing really that I can add as it's a class I have wanted to play but haven't gotten around to playing, one thing to remember is that they can turn one use of any spell like ability or spell into a use of an Inflict Spell that doesn't use negative energy and thus can be used on undead (and technically constructs that aren't immune to magic) of the same level. If you can find a way to get an at will spell like ability you have an at will inflict spell that gets around the things usually immune.
